1998 Mazda 3.0l (B3000) automatic

What were original symptoms?
If crank sensor is bad engine would not start, ever

Cam sensor issue can cause rough running, but so can a host of other things
Cam sensor issue WILL turn on CEL(check engine light) and set cam sensor codes
In 1998 you should have a 3 wire cam sensor, 1999 and up used 2 wire and they are NOT interchangeable

If no CEL then you have a mechanical issue, not a sensor issue
3.0l Coil Packs did have issues
Pull out spark plugs and have a look at the tips, see if they show Rich running or oil burning issue

Coil pack spark plug wires are easy to mix up
3 4
2 6
1 5

Those are the matched pairs, 3/4, 2/6, 1/5 on the coil pack
So NOT
3 6
2 5
1 4


How long have you owned this vehicle?
How long has it been "running fine"

Anyone can get "bad gas", and at anytime, has a high water content, so engine is running fine and you fill up and then a day or two later engine is running poorly, "what the heck???"
Simplest explanation is often the correct one, so don't over think things
